【 摘 要 】

Novel high-performance Ni-rGO coated polymer (NiGP) foams for EMI shielding were developed with a dip-coating and reduction method. The obtained NiGP3 foams with a thickness of 10 mm prepared by 3 rounds of dip-coating, exhibited excellent EMI shieling effectiveness (EMI SE) of 24.03-27.71 dB at 30-1500MHz, which can fully meet the requirement of practical application. Furthermore, the NiGP foams maintain the compressibility of the original polymer foams.
